City of McAllen Hires New Aviation Director for McAllen International Airport

Courtesy Xochitl Mora, (McAllen, Texas)-The City of McAllen hired Jeremy Santoscoy, P.E. as its new Director of Aviation of McAllen International Airport. The Rio Grande Valley native has 18 years of experience with the City of McAllen, serving most recently as the Deputy Director for the Airport and previously as Transportation Engineer. Rep. Cuellar Hosts Webinar on Veterans Benefits

Courtesy Arturo Olivarez, Washington, DC – U.S. Congressman Henry Cuellar, Ph.D. (TX-28) hosted an informational webinar on current benefits available to veterans and their families. Representatives from the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) discussed a wide range of benefits for crucial areas, including: VA Health Care Disability Compensation Education and Training Home Loans Employment
